Just over 20 years ago when our children were small (and no restaurants had high chairs etc, even Mothercare had no changing mats) you could buy a fabric thing, shaped a bit like an apron, into which you could put a baby or toddler and then tie the thing firmly onto the back of a restaurant chair. (It folded small so you could put it in a handbag or large pocket and have it available when needed.) Maybe they still make these, or you could make your own, which would mean you could eat at any restaurant you like.

  14. Sorry but I think this is a crazy idea. Yes, we do need at least one more pedestrian crossing but as for making this important road through East Dulwich pedestrians-only, it could never work. A round about route would add simply ages to bus journeys, making more people jump in their cars and would also stop people who do not live nearby visiting the area and spending money in the local shops and cafes.
